Step 2: Water Extraction
Using advanced equipment, our technician will extract as much water as possible from your hardwood floors, reducing the risk of further damage and costly repairs. We use specialized pumps to remove standing water, and our team will also use industrial fans to speed up the drying process. Our goal is to reduce downtime and get you back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ted, our team will use industrial d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. We’ll monitor the humidity levels to ensure your floors are drying evenly and efficiently.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Cost in Hyde Park, UT
The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hyde Park, UT. Our team will provide a detailed estimate for the repairs, and we’ll work with you to find out the best course of action. Our goal is to deliver exceptional results at a fair price.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Refinishing and sanding |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of finish, and number of coats |
| Dehumidification and humidity control |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ment, and duration of treatment |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of damage |
| Repair and restoration | $1,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air, and number of materials needed |
| Follow-up inspections and maintenance | $100 – $500 | Frequency of inspections and type of maintenance needed |
